JIMMY BARNES is no stranger to the a day on the green stage, both as a solo performer and with Cold Chisel, however it’s been four years since his last winery concerts as a solo artist.

“I’ve played many a day on the green concerts over the years both with my band and with Cold Chisel and we’ve always had an absolute blast,” Jimmy says. “It’s a fantastic way to enjoy music, sitting back with your friends in a great location. a day on the green’s support of Australian music should be commended because the line-ups are first-class. We all have a great time catching up backstage! There’s always a good feeling across the whole day which makes it a pleasure to play.”

It is hard to believe but 2014 will mark 30 years since Jimmy began his solo career! Since the release of his debut album ‘Bodyswerve’ in 1984, he has notched up more #1 ARIA albums (nine) than any other Australian artist – an amazing achievement. Cold Chisel’s triumphant sell-out return to the stage in 2011 added another chapter to that band’s amazing legacy and reaffirmed – not that there were any doubts – that Jimmy reigns supreme as not only the undisputed king of Australian rock’n’roll but also one of our most-loved performers.

To say THE ANGELS have been rejuvenated since the arrival of Dave Gleeson is somewhat of an understatement! After 18 months of killer gigs and the great reception to their first studio album in 14 years, 2012’s ‘Take It To The Streets’, the band has been energized with new optimism. Their second album with Gleeson at the helm called ‘Talk The Talk’ is out on January 17.

IAN ‘Mossy’ MOSS holds a revered place in Australian music. Performing songs covering both his Cold Chisel and solo careers, Mossy’s soulful vocals and incredible guitar playing ensure his live sets are always amazing. Following the extraordinary Cold Chisel reunion tour, this master musician will be in red hot form.

The release of DARYL BRAITHWAITE’s new album “Forever The Tourist” and rejoining Sony Music, the home of his hugely successful solo records in the 80s, has been called a “comeback” but his hordes of fans across Australia will attest that he has never really been away. From Sherbet days to solo hits like ‘As The Days Go By’, ‘Horses’ and ‘One Summer’, Daryl has continued to do what he loves best –  performing to a dedicated fan base all over the country.

RICHARD CLAPTON has endeared himself to music-lovers everywhere through his heartfelt inspired performances and a songbook that defines our times.  With hits like ‘Girls On The Avenue’, ‘Deep Water’, ‘Capricorn Dancer’ and ‘I Am An Island’ Richard was a thoroughly deserving and popular inductee into the ARIA Hall Of Fame. In late 2012 he released his first album in eight years “Harlequin Nights” to universal acclaim.

Growing out of the fertile post-punk scene in Melbourne, BOOM CRASH OPERA hit heady heights with smash hits ‘Great Wall’, ‘The Best Thing’, ‘Onionskin’, ‘Dancing In The Storm’ and ‘Get Out Of The House’.  The band members have continued to work in music, theatre and TV worlds, reconvening sporadically for live appearances.
